(refs #1251, #1256) add admin, upload and api to reserved.

This commit is contained in:
nazoking
2016-08-03 12:14:32 +09:00
parent 7fd0cdd7d8
commit 0499c47f4b

View File

@@ -244,8 +244,9 @@ trait AccountManagementControllerBase extends ControllerBase {
.map { _ => "Mail address is already registered." } .map { _ => "Mail address is already registered." }
} }
val allReservedNames = Set("git", "admin", "upload", "api")
protected def reservedNames(): Constraint = new Constraint(){ protected def reservedNames(): Constraint = new Constraint(){
override def validate(name: String, value: String, messages: Messages): Option[String] = if(value == "git"){ override def validate(name: String, value: String, messages: Messages): Option[String] = if(allReservedNames.contains(value)){
Some(s"${value} is reserved") Some(s"${value} is reserved")
}else{ }else{
None None